In physics terms the difference between scintillation and fluorescence
is that scintillation is the flash of light produced by a phosphor when it absorbs ionizing radiation while fluorescence is the emission of light (or other electromagnetic radiation) by a material when stimulated by the absorption of radiation or of a subatomic particle.
As nouns the difference between scintillation and fluorescence
is that scintillation is a flash of light; a spark while fluorescence is the emission of light (or other electromagnetic radiation) by a material when stimulated by the absorption of radiation or of a subatomic particle.
